Description:

A Group Six Pre-Columbian Carved Stone Ornaments, Mixtec, each of full figural form, height 1 in. to 2 1/4 in. Provenance: Collected by Ralph Fabacher and Higford Griffiths; to Alice Hogg Hanszen; to the Museum of Fine Arts, Houston, 1965; sold Neal Auction Company, March 27, 2010, lot 624; to current owner. Exhibited: "Pre-Columbian Art from Middle America", Museum of Fine Arts, Houston, February 35, 1966 - August 1. 1966.
